Partnerships

Icon

Retail Partners

Leal collaborates with numerous retailers in Latin America to enhance customer engagement and loyalty. These partnerships are essential for expanding Leal's market presence. In 2024, Leal's platform supported over 10,000 retailers. This network is key to Leal's value proposition for businesses and consumers.

Icon

Technology Providers

Leal relies on tech providers to boost its platform. This includes AI for better data analysis and marketing, plus cloud services for security. In 2024, the global AI market was valued at $196.63 billion. Cloud computing spending is expected to reach $678.8 billion by the end of 2024.

Explore a Preview
Icon

Payment Processors

Payment processors are crucial for Leal, enabling smooth integration of loyalty programs with transactions. This partnership simplifies reward accrual for customers and purchase tracking for retailers. For example, in 2024, the global payment processing market was valued at over $80 billion, demonstrating its significance.

Activities

Icon

Platform Development and Maintenance

Platform development and maintenance are central to Leal's operations. This includes ongoing updates, security enhancements, and new feature implementations. In 2024, digital platform spending increased by 15% across retail. Regular maintenance ensures the platform remains functional and competitive. This activity is crucial for user satisfaction and data security.

Icon

Customer Data Management and Analysis

Leal's customer data management centers on gathering and analyzing customer data to inform retailers. This includes tracking customer interactions and purchase histories. In 2024, effective customer data analytics can boost sales by up to 20%. Retailers use these insights to personalize offers.

Explore a Preview
Icon

Developing and Managing Loyalty Programs

Leal excels in designing, implementing, and managing loyalty programs. This helps retailers reward customers and drive repeat business. In 2024, loyalty programs saw a 15% rise in adoption among small businesses. Businesses using such programs reported a 20% increase in customer retention rates. This approach supports Leal's core value proposition.

Icon

Sales and Onboarding of Retailers

Leal's success hinges on consistently attracting and integrating new retail partners. This involves targeted sales strategies and a streamlined onboarding process to ensure retailers quickly adopt the platform. Effective sales efforts drive network expansion, increasing Leal's value. In 2024, successful onboarding saw a 20% increase in active retailers.

  • Sales team targets: 100 new retailers per quarter.
  • Onboarding time goal: Less than 2 weeks.
  • Retailer retention rate: Aiming for 90%.
  • Onboarding cost: $500 per retailer.

Value Propositions

Icon

For Retailers: Enhanced Customer Engagement

Leal helps retailers boost customer engagement. They gain insights to foster loyalty and repeat sales. Leal's tools improve understanding of customer behavior. Retailers using similar strategies saw a 15% rise in repeat purchases in 2024. This leads to better customer relationships.

Icon

For Retailers: Data-Driven Insights

Leal provides retailers with data-driven insights into customer behavior, improving marketing strategies. Retailers can analyze sales trends and customer preferences. This data allows for better inventory management and personalized promotions. In 2024, retailers using data analytics saw, on average, a 15% increase in sales.

Explore a Preview
Icon

For Retailers: Increased Sales and Revenue

Leal's platform boosts retailer revenue by fostering customer loyalty. It enables targeted marketing, increasing purchase frequency and average spending. In 2024, loyalty programs drove a 15% increase in sales for retailers using similar strategies. This translates to significant revenue growth.

Icon

For Customers: Centralized Loyalty Programs and Rewards

Leal simplifies customer loyalty by providing a centralized hub for managing rewards across different retailers. This platform allows customers to effortlessly track and redeem points, enhancing their overall shopping experience. According to recent data, 79% of consumers are more likely to engage with businesses that offer loyalty programs. Leal's approach boosts customer retention by consolidating various programs into one user-friendly interface. It streamlines the earning and redemption process, driving repeat business and customer satisfaction.

  • Centralized access to loyalty programs.
  • Simplified reward tracking and redemption.
  • Enhanced customer engagement and retention.
  • Improved shopping experience.
Icon

For Customers: Personalized Offers and Experiences

Leal's value proposition centers on personalized offers. Customers receive tailored deals based on their buying habits. This enhances the shopping experience. Relevant incentives drive engagement and loyalty.

  • Personalized offers increase customer lifetime value by up to 25%.
  • Relevant incentives can boost purchase frequency by 15%.
  • Data from 2024 shows 70% of consumers prefer personalized experiences.
  • Leal's system analyzes millions of transactions daily to refine offers.
